When is the best time for a budget trip to Ramat Gan?
Weather is probably a major factor when you plan your trip to Ramat Gan, and keep in mind that cheaper options are usually available when the weather isn’t as good. The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 81°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 60°F. Average annual precipitation for Ramat Gan is 15 inches.
What is there to see and do in Ramat Gan?
Ramat Gan is known for its bar scene and offers things to see and do without spending a fortune. You can budget for the local attractions that interest you most, and then plan some activities that are easy on the wallet. Hunt for bargains with some shopping at Ayalon Mall and Azrieli Center, or get outdoors at Yarkon Park.
How can I get to Ramat Gan and get around on a budget?
Scoping out the transportation options in Ramat Gan can help keep you on budget. The nearest airport is 5.4 mi (8.7 km) away from the center in Ben Gurion Airport (TLV). Ramat Gan might not have many public transit options to choose from so a rental car could be a reasonable alternative to see more of the area.
